How they compare
Late-demographic dividend currently reports 72.93 million against 5.50 million in Mexico, a difference of 67.43 million.
That makes Late-demographic dividend's figure about 13.3 times Mexico's.
Across all 66 years both countries report, Late-demographic dividend has been ahead every year.
Late-demographic dividend ranks 12th and Mexico ranks 13th of 41 groups.
Late-demographic dividend has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Late-demographic dividend | Mexico |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 67.94 million | 2.72 million | 65.23 million | Late-demographic dividend |
| 1970s | 81.47 million | 3.85 million | 77.61 million | Late-demographic dividend |
| 1980s | 90.85 million | 4.97 million | 85.88 million | Late-demographic dividend |
| 1990s | 86.94 million | 5.24 million | 81.70 million | Late-demographic dividend |
| 2000s | 83.29 million | 5.52 million | 77.76 million | Late-demographic dividend |
| 2010s | 67.04 million | 5.55 million | 61.49 million | Late-demographic dividend |
| 2020s | 71.16 million | 5.52 million | 65.64 million | Late-demographic dividend |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
